{"id":"https://openalex.org/W2029671009","doi":"https://doi.org/10.1145/2791060.2791073","title":"Delta-oriented test case prioritization for integration testing of software product lines","display_name":"Delta-oriented test case prioritization for integration testing of software product lines","publication_year":2015,"publication_date":"2015-07-20","ids":{"openalex":"https://openalex.org/W2029671009","doi":"https://doi.org/10.1145/2791060.2791073","mag":"2029671009"},"language":"en","primary_location":{"id":"doi:10.1145/2791060.2791073","is_oa":false,"landing_page_url":"https://doi.org/10.1145/2791060.2791073","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 19th International Conference on Software Product Line","raw_type":"proceedings-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5057766093","display_name":"Remo Lachmann","orcid":null},"institutions":[{"id":"https://openalex.org/I94509681","display_name":"Technische Universit\u00e4t Braunschweig","ror":"https://ror.org/010nsgg66","country_code":"DE","type":"education","lineage":["https://openalex.org/I94509681"]}],"countries":["DE"],"is_corresponding":true,"raw_author_name":"Remo Lachmann","raw_affiliation_strings":["Technische Universit\u00e4t Braunschweig"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Technische Universit\u00e4t Braunschweig","institution_ids":["https://openalex.org/I94509681"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5072640228","display_name":"Sascha Lity","orcid":null},"institutions":[{"id":"https://openalex.org/I94509681","display_name":"Technische Universit\u00e4t Braunschweig","ror":"https://ror.org/010nsgg66","country_code":"DE","type":"education","lineage":["https://openalex.org/I94509681"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Sascha Lity","raw_affiliation_strings":["Technische Universit\u00e4t Braunschweig"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Technische Universit\u00e4t Braunschweig","institution_ids":["https://openalex.org/I94509681"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5082107375","display_name":"Sabrina Lischke","orcid":null},"institutions":[{"id":"https://openalex.org/I94509681","display_name":"Technische Universit\u00e4t Braunschweig","ror":"https://ror.org/010nsgg66","country_code":"DE","type":"education","lineage":["https://openalex.org/I94509681"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Sabrina Lischke","raw_affiliation_strings":["Technische Universit\u00e4t Braunschweig"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Technische Universit\u00e4t Braunschweig","institution_ids":["https://openalex.org/I94509681"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5078978823","display_name":"Simon Beddig","orcid":null},"institutions":[{"id":"https://openalex.org/I94509681","display_name":"Technische Universit\u00e4t Braunschweig","ror":"https://ror.org/010nsgg66","country_code":"DE","type":"education","lineage":["https://openalex.org/I94509681"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Simon Beddig","raw_affiliation_strings":["Technische Universit\u00e4t Braunschweig"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Technische Universit\u00e4t Braunschweig","institution_ids":["https://openalex.org/I94509681"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5017178235","display_name":"Sandro Schulze","orcid":"https://orcid.org/0000-0002-7198-7848"},"institutions":[{"id":"https://openalex.org/I94509681","display_name":"Technische Universit\u00e4t Braunschweig","ror":"https://ror.org/010nsgg66","country_code":"DE","type":"education","lineage":["https://openalex.org/I94509681"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Sandro Schulze","raw_affiliation_strings":["Technische Universit\u00e4t Braunschweig"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Technische Universit\u00e4t Braunschweig","institution_ids":["https://openalex.org/I94509681"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5065261670","display_name":"Ina Schaefer","orcid":"https://orcid.org/0000-0002-7153-761X"},"institutions":[{"id":"https://openalex.org/I94509681","display_name":"Technische Universit\u00e4t Braunschweig","ror":"https://ror.org/010nsgg66","country_code":"DE","type":"education","lineage":["https://openalex.org/I94509681"]}],"countries":["DE"],"is_corresponding":false,"raw_author_name":"Ina Schaefer","raw_affiliation_strings":["Technische Universit\u00e4t Braunschweig"],"raw_orcid":null,"affiliations":[{"raw_affiliation_string":"Technische Universit\u00e4t Braunschweig","institution_ids":["https://openalex.org/I94509681"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":6,"corresponding_author_ids":["https://openalex.org/A5057766093"],"corresponding_institution_ids":["https://openalex.org/I94509681"],"apc_list":null,"apc_paid":null,"fwci":5.7888,"has_fulltext":false,"cited_by_count":41,"citation_normalized_percentile":{"value":0.9610873,"is_in_top_1_percent":false,"is_in_top_10_percent":true},"cited_by_percentile_year":{"min":94,"max":99},"biblio":{"volume":null,"issue":null,"first_page":"81","last_page":"90"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10639","display_name":"Advanced Software Engineering Methodologies","score":0.9997000098228455,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10639","display_name":"Advanced Software Engineering Methodologies","score":0.9997000098228455,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10743","display_name":"Software Testing and Debugging Techniques","score":0.9993000030517578,"subfield":{"id":"https://openalex.org/subfields/1712","display_name":"Software"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11450","display_name":"Model-Driven Software Engineering Techniques","score":0.9962000250816345,"subfield":{"id":"https://openalex.org/subfields/1712","display_name":"Software"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.6773948073387146},{"id":"https://openalex.org/keywords/software-product-line","display_name":"Software product line","score":0.58486008644104},{"id":"https://openalex.org/keywords/regression-testing","display_name":"Regression testing","score":0.5702539682388306},{"id":"https://openalex.org/keywords/integration-testing","display_name":"Integration testing","score":0.5690908432006836},{"id":"https://openalex.org/keywords/test-strategy","display_name":"Test strategy","score":0.5674889087677002},{"id":"https://openalex.org/keywords/test-case","display_name":"Test case","score":0.5253607630729675},{"id":"https://openalex.org/keywords/black-box-testing","display_name":"Black-box testing","score":0.504083514213562},{"id":"https://openalex.org/keywords/redundancy","display_name":"Redundancy (engineering)","score":0.503722608089447},{"id":"https://openalex.org/keywords/reliability-engineering","display_name":"Reliability engineering","score":0.4837636947631836},{"id":"https://openalex.org/keywords/system-integration-testing","display_name":"System integration testing","score":0.47723129391670227},{"id":"https://openalex.org/keywords/product","display_name":"Product (mathematics)","score":0.4436284303665161},{"id":"https://openalex.org/keywords/software","display_name":"Software","score":0.42681729793548584},{"id":"https://openalex.org/keywords/software-engineering","display_name":"Software engineering","score":0.36545538902282715},{"id":"https://openalex.org/keywords/software-development","display_name":"Software development","score":0.2493031620979309},{"id":"https://openalex.org/keywords/software-quality","display_name":"Software quality","score":0.2259937822818756},{"id":"https://openalex.org/keywords/software-construction","display_name":"Software construction","score":0.213424414396286},{"id":"https://openalex.org/keywords/engineering","display_name":"Engineering","score":0.17140048742294312},{"id":"https://openalex.org/keywords/machine-learning","display_name":"Machine learning","score":0.11644405126571655},{"id":"https://openalex.org/keywords/operating-system","display_name":"Operating system","score":0.09900584816932678},{"id":"https://openalex.org/keywords/mathematics","display_name":"Mathematics","score":0.06843200325965881}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.6773948073387146},{"id":"https://openalex.org/C2778177629","wikidata":"https://www.wikidata.org/wiki/Q2111823","display_name":"Software product line","level":4,"score":0.58486008644104},{"id":"https://openalex.org/C161821725","wikidata":"https://www.wikidata.org/wiki/Q917415","display_name":"Regression testing","level":5,"score":0.5702539682388306},{"id":"https://openalex.org/C107683887","wikidata":"https://www.wikidata.org/wiki/Q782466","display_name":"Integration testing","level":3,"score":0.5690908432006836},{"id":"https://openalex.org/C188598960","wikidata":"https://www.wikidata.org/wiki/Q7705805","display_name":"Test strategy","level":3,"score":0.5674889087677002},{"id":"https://openalex.org/C128942645","wikidata":"https://www.wikidata.org/wiki/Q1568346","display_name":"Test case","level":3,"score":0.5253607630729675},{"id":"https://openalex.org/C24169984","wikidata":"https://www.wikidata.org/wiki/Q879969","display_name":"Black-box testing","level":5,"score":0.504083514213562},{"id":"https://openalex.org/C152124472","wikidata":"https://www.wikidata.org/wiki/Q1204361","display_name":"Redundancy (engineering)","level":2,"score":0.503722608089447},{"id":"https://openalex.org/C200601418","wikidata":"https://www.wikidata.org/wiki/Q2193887","display_name":"Reliability engineering","level":1,"score":0.4837636947631836},{"id":"https://openalex.org/C111524372","wikidata":"https://www.wikidata.org/wiki/Q7663718","display_name":"System integration testing","level":5,"score":0.47723129391670227},{"id":"https://openalex.org/C90673727","wikidata":"https://www.wikidata.org/wiki/Q901718","display_name":"Product (mathematics)","level":2,"score":0.4436284303665161},{"id":"https://openalex.org/C2777904410","wikidata":"https://www.wikidata.org/wiki/Q7397","display_name":"Software","level":2,"score":0.42681729793548584},{"id":"https://openalex.org/C115903868","wikidata":"https://www.wikidata.org/wiki/Q80993","display_name":"Software engineering","level":1,"score":0.36545538902282715},{"id":"https://openalex.org/C529173508","wikidata":"https://www.wikidata.org/wiki/Q638608","display_name":"Software development","level":3,"score":0.2493031620979309},{"id":"https://openalex.org/C117447612","wikidata":"https://www.wikidata.org/wiki/Q1412670","display_name":"Software quality","level":4,"score":0.2259937822818756},{"id":"https://openalex.org/C186846655","wikidata":"https://www.wikidata.org/wiki/Q3398377","display_name":"Software construction","level":4,"score":0.213424414396286},{"id":"https://openalex.org/C127413603","wikidata":"https://www.wikidata.org/wiki/Q11023","display_name":"Engineering","level":0,"score":0.17140048742294312},{"id":"https://openalex.org/C119857082","wikidata":"https://www.wikidata.org/wiki/Q2539","display_name":"Machine learning","level":1,"score":0.11644405126571655},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.09900584816932678},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.06843200325965881},{"id":"https://openalex.org/C2524010","wikidata":"https://www.wikidata.org/wiki/Q8087","display_name":"Geometry","level":1,"score":0.0},{"id":"https://openalex.org/C152877465","wikidata":"https://www.wikidata.org/wiki/Q208042","display_name":"Regression analysis","level":2,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1145/2791060.2791073","is_oa":false,"landing_page_url":"https://doi.org/10.1145/2791060.2791073","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"Proceedings of the 19th International Conference on Software Product Line","raw_type":"proceedings-article"}],"best_oa_location":null,"sustainable_development_goals":[],"awards":[],"funders":[{"id":"https://openalex.org/F4320320879","display_name":"Deutsche Forschungsgemeinschaft","ror":"https://ror.org/018mejw64"}],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":30,"referenced_works":["https://openalex.org/W116291049","https://openalex.org/W1144393388","https://openalex.org/W1547145819","https://openalex.org/W1585229511","https://openalex.org/W1925282067","https://openalex.org/W1977497804","https://openalex.org/W1979563929","https://openalex.org/W2005195948","https://openalex.org/W2014515160","https://openalex.org/W2049637488","https://openalex.org/W2058783477","https://openalex.org/W2071160808","https://openalex.org/W2075539908","https://openalex.org/W2090539172","https://openalex.org/W2099335480","https://openalex.org/W2105438268","https://openalex.org/W2110068396","https://openalex.org/W2110553552","https://openalex.org/W2112238455","https://openalex.org/W2115910430","https://openalex.org/W2125674137","https://openalex.org/W2137965151","https://openalex.org/W2141226346","https://openalex.org/W2152417223","https://openalex.org/W2152766145","https://openalex.org/W2167406760","https://openalex.org/W2167500728","https://openalex.org/W4231859022","https://openalex.org/W4285719527","https://openalex.org/W6634953585"],"related_works":["https://openalex.org/W2886756146","https://openalex.org/W1603792055","https://openalex.org/W4230389880","https://openalex.org/W1988901622","https://openalex.org/W2766263634","https://openalex.org/W2273715643","https://openalex.org/W3214776400","https://openalex.org/W3197709817","https://openalex.org/W2022894844","https://openalex.org/W2335749738"],"abstract_inverted_index":{"Software":[0],"product":[1,19,34,51,55,80,120],"lines":[2],"have":[3,152],"potential":[4],"to":[5,26,45,67,82,175],"allow":[6],"for":[7,97,118],"mass":[8],"customization":[9],"of":[10,17,50,76,127,141,170],"products.":[11],"Unfortunately,":[12],"the":[13,46,74,113,125,147,157],"resulting,":[14],"vast":[15],"amount":[16],"possible":[18],"variants":[20,81],"with":[21],"commonalities":[22,75],"and":[23,63,160],"differences":[24],"leads":[25],"new":[27,61],"challenges":[28],"in":[29,40,85],"software":[30,77],"testing.":[31,86],"Ideally,":[32],"every":[33,54,119],"variant":[35,56,121],"should":[36],"be":[37],"tested,":[38,123],"especially":[39],"safety-critical":[41],"systems.":[42],"However,":[43],"due":[44],"exponentially":[47],"increasing":[48],"number":[49,126],"variants,":[52],"testing":[53,71,95,133,177],"is":[57],"not":[58],"feasible.":[59],"Thus,":[60],"concepts":[62],"techniques":[64],"are":[65,122],"required":[66],"provide":[68],"efficient":[69,93],"SPL":[70],"strategies":[72],"exploiting":[73],"artifacts":[78],"between":[79],"reduce":[83],"redundancy":[84],"In":[87],"this":[88],"paper,":[89],"we":[90],"present":[91,156],"an":[92],"integration":[94],"approach":[96],"SPLs":[98],"based":[99],"on":[100,105],"delta":[101],"modeling.":[102],"We":[103,155],"focus":[104],"test":[106,116,129,150,172],"case":[107],"prioritization.":[108],"As":[109],"a":[110,167],"result,":[111],"only":[112],"most":[114,148],"important":[115,149],"cases":[117,130,151,173],"reducing":[124],"executed":[128,171],"significantly,":[131],"as":[132],"can":[134],"stop":[135],"at":[136],"any":[137],"given":[138],"point":[139],"because":[140],"resource":[142],"constraints":[143],"while":[144],"ensuring":[145],"that":[146],"been":[153],"covered.":[154],"general":[158],"concept":[159],"our":[161],"evaluation":[162],"results.":[163],"The":[164],"results":[165],"show":[166],"measurable":[168],"reduction":[169],"compared":[174],"single-software":[176],"approaches.":[178]},"counts_by_year":[{"year":2026,"cited_by_count":1},{"year":2025,"cited_by_count":2},{"year":2024,"cited_by_count":3},{"year":2023,"cited_by_count":7},{"year":2022,"cited_by_count":2},{"year":2021,"cited_by_count":6},{"year":2020,"cited_by_count":3},{"year":2019,"cited_by_count":4},{"year":2018,"cited_by_count":4},{"year":2017,"cited_by_count":5},{"year":2016,"cited_by_count":4}],"updated_date":"2026-05-11T08:15:01.531666","created_date":"2025-10-10T00:00:00"}
